Output 5a9764aecfda2456e8640c85b1e388132602edc51954eff188426def559af8ae:0

value
14668059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9072a3831bcf75157e784f928116ea53a9ff84d OP_EQUAL
address
3MUZ8zrc4MTXQbu5Mrm31pLaKDGmGQW5wj
transaction
5a9764aecfda2456e8640c85b1e388132602edc51954eff188426def559af8ae
spent
true